Property is move-in ready.
While built in 1969, the property has undergone significant renovations likely within the 5-15 year range. The kitchen features updated stainless steel appliances and backsplash, and both bathrooms have been modernized with contemporary vanities and tile work. With fresh interior/exterior paint and a well-maintained deck, the home is functional and move-in ready.
The spacious 4-bedroom, 2-bathroom single-level floor plan offers 1,770 square feet of accessible living space, making it highly desirable for families and those seeking long-term accessibility.
The property features a large deck and a productive backyard orchard with mature apple, orange, and plum trees, providing an established outdoor oasis for gardening and entertaining.
Residents benefit from a low $60 monthly HOA fee that includes community pool access and rare RV/boat parking, all while maintaining proximity to downtown Petaluma and Hwy 101.
Built in 1969, the home likely requires significant interior modernization beyond the fresh paint to update original systems and finishes to contemporary standards.
The 6,499 square foot lot is relatively modest for a four-bedroom residence, which may limit future expansion possibilities or large-scale private outdoor projects.
